If you ever wondered what happened to 'Lady Mary Crawley' after Downton Abbey finished, now's your chance to find out.

Well, not exactly, but Michelle Dockery who played the member of the British aristocracy in the period drama returns to the small screen in her new crime noir drama on TNT, Good Behavior.
Trying to play almost the opposite of her post-Edwardian English character with all its airs and graces (and gowns), she plays 'Letty Raines', the troubled drinking, druggy ex-con trying to go straight in South Carolina.
Like the tagline says, she's 'bad at being good' and after being released from prison she soon falls back on her old con artist tricks, stealing and grifting in disguises, until she meets a sexy hitman, 'Javier' (played by Juan Deigo Botto), and becomes embroiled in his contract killer schemes.
